The Little Ferry housing market is somewhat competitive. The median sale price of a home in Little Ferry was $290K last month, down 43.4% since last year. The median sale price per square foot in Little Ferry is $403, up 6.6% since last year.
What is the housing market like in Little Ferry today?
In June 2025, Little Ferry home prices were down 43.4% compared to last year, selling for a median price of $290K. On average, homes in Little Ferry sell after 66 days on the market compared to 56 days last year. There were 3 homes sold in June this year, down from 6 last year.

Little Ferry Migration & Relocation Trends
In Feb '25 - Apr '25, 31% of Little Ferry homebuyers searched to move out of Little Ferry, while 69% looked to stay within the metropolitan area.
Where are people moving to Little Ferry from?
Across the nation, 3% of homebuyers searched to move into Little Ferry from outside metros.
Los Angeles homebuyers searched to move into Little Ferry more than any other metro followed by Vineyard Haven and Spokane.
Where are people from Little Ferry moving to?
69% of Little Ferry homebuyers searched to stay within the Little Ferry metropolitan area.
Miami was the most popular destination among Little Ferry homebuyers followed by Philadelphia and Boston.
This data does not reflect actual moves. The latest migration analysis is based on a sample of about two
million Redfin.com users who searched for homes across more than 100 metro areas. To be included in this dataset, a Redfin.com user
must have viewed at least 10 homes in a three month period. This dataset excludes all rentals data.

Climate's impact on Little Ferry housing
Learn about natural hazards and environmental risks, such as floods, fires, wind, and heat that
could impact homes in Little Ferry.
Flood Factor - Minor
72% of properties are at risk of severe flooding over the next 30 years
Flood Factor
Little Ferry has a minor risk of flooding. 546 properties in Little Ferry are likely to be
severely affected
by flooding over the next 30 years. This represents 72% of all properties in Little Ferry. Flood risk is increasing slower than the national average.
100% of properties are at major
risk of a severe wind event over the next 30 years
Wind Factor
Little Ferry has a Major Wind Factor® risk based on the projected likelihood and speed of hurricane, tornado, or severe storm winds impacting it. Little Ferry is most at risk from hurricanes. 2,604 properties in Little Ferry have some risk of being in a severe wind event within the next 30 years.
Wind likelihood over time
If an exceedingly rare windstorm
(a 1-in-3,000 year storm event)
occurred today, it could cause wind gusts of up to 78 mph. In 30 years, an event of this same likelihood would show increased wind gusts of up to 87 mph.
